Directory By Molecular Formula / C / C20H24N2O4S

Browse commercially available molecule directory by molecule formula.

Molport-043-629-552

Molport-043-629-552

View Details
Molport-043-629-661

Molport-043-629-661

View Details
Molport-043-629-772

Molport-043-629-772

View Details
Molport-043-629-847

Molport-043-629-847

View Details
Molport-043-630-180

Molport-043-630-180

View Details
Molport-043-630-300

Molport-043-630-300

View Details
Molport-043-630-408

Molport-043-630-408

View Details
Molport-043-630-520

Molport-043-630-520

View Details
Molport-043-630-595

Molport-043-630-595

View Details
Molport-043-630-706

Molport-043-630-706

View Details
Molport-043-630-822

Molport-043-630-822

View Details
Molport-043-630-935

Molport-043-630-935

View Details
Molport-043-631-046

Molport-043-631-046

View Details
Molport-043-631-262

Molport-043-631-262

View Details
Molport-043-631-370

Molport-043-631-370

View Details
Molport-043-667-226

Molport-043-667-226

View Details
Molport-043-667-422

Molport-043-667-422

View Details
Molport-043-669-657

Molport-043-669-657

View Details
Molport-043-669-658

Molport-043-669-658

View Details
Molport-043-669-767

Molport-043-669-767

View Details
Molport-043-669-768

Molport-043-669-768

View Details
Molport-043-669-877

Molport-043-669-877

View Details
Molport-043-669-878

Molport-043-669-878

View Details
Molport-043-669-987

Molport-043-669-987

View Details
Molport-043-669-988

Molport-043-669-988

View Details
Molport-043-670-404

Molport-043-670-404

View Details
Molport-043-670-478

Molport-043-670-478

View Details
Molport-043-671-053

Molport-043-671-053

View Details
Molport-043-671-054

Molport-043-671-054

View Details
Molport-043-672-923

Molport-043-672-923

View Details
Molport-043-672-924

Molport-043-672-924

View Details
Molport-043-673-033

Molport-043-673-033

View Details
Molport-043-673-034

Molport-043-673-034

View Details
Molport-043-673-143

Molport-043-673-143

View Details
Molport-043-673-144

Molport-043-673-144

View Details
Molport-043-673-253

Molport-043-673-253

View Details
Molport-043-673-254

Molport-043-673-254

View Details
Molport-043-673-363

Molport-043-673-363

View Details
Molport-043-673-364

Molport-043-673-364

View Details
Molport-043-673-473

Molport-043-673-473

View Details
Molport-043-673-474

Molport-043-673-474

View Details
Molport-043-673-583

Molport-043-673-583

View Details
Molport-043-673-584

Molport-043-673-584

View Details
Molport-043-673-693

Molport-043-673-693

View Details
Molport-043-673-694

Molport-043-673-694

View Details
Molport-043-675-315

Molport-043-675-315

View Details
Molport-043-675-338

Molport-043-675-338

View Details
Molport-043-675-374

Molport-043-675-374

View Details
Molport-043-675-424

Molport-043-675-424

View Details
Molport-043-675-447

Molport-043-675-447

View Details
Molport-043-675-483

Molport-043-675-483

View Details
Molport-043-675-533

Molport-043-675-533

View Details
Molport-043-675-556

Molport-043-675-556

View Details
Molport-043-675-592

Molport-043-675-592

View Details
Molport-043-675-648

Molport-043-675-648

View Details
Molport-043-675-722

Molport-043-675-722

View Details
Molport-043-675-800

Molport-043-675-800

View Details
Molport-043-676-147

Molport-043-676-147

View Details
Molport-043-676-148

Molport-043-676-148

View Details
Molport-043-676-149

Molport-043-676-149

View Details

We use cookies to improve your experience on our websites and for advertising. By clicking "Accept All", you consent to our use of cookies.